Transaction 9f31a0b423ac869695426537d3dcbb83bd92558f5cce38265ab0007a2d38265a
1 Input
1 Output
-
9f31a0b423ac869695426537d3dcbb83bd92558f5cce38265ab0007a2d38265a:0
- value
- 21099322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40b5e7f391ef1f406be76c0c985f013a8a538f5b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16uAALFATRcPzuUx4Tih5LS1KKJ6iacyrb